Technical Field
The application relates to the field of orthopedics, in particular to a spine protection device for treating orthopedic patients.
Background
Orthopedics is one of the most common departments of various hospitals, mainly studies the anatomy, physiology and pathology of the skeletal muscle system, maintains and develops the normal form and function of the system by using medicines, operations and physical methods, and the spine needs to be fixed by a protective device after the spine operation is completed, so that the rehabilitation quality is improved.
The existing protection device mainly fixes the back of a human body, lacks the support and protection of the spine and the waist, and patients often can cause secondary injury by getting up and bending down, and need to be provided with a fixed structure at the front part of the human body. Therefore, a spine protection device for treating an orthopedic patient is provided to solve the above problems.

Referring to fig. 1-6, a spine protection device for orthopedic patient treatment includes a first housing 1, a second housing 8, a housing cover 13, a second threaded rod 15, a ventilation mechanism and a fixing mechanism;
the breathable mechanism comprises a support frame 10, a bamboo charcoal layer 20 and a sponge layer, the outer wall surface of the first shell 1 and the outer wall surface of the second shell 8 are fixedly connected with the support frame 10 through bolts respectively, the outer wall surface of the support frame 10 is fixedly connected with breathable gauze 11, the inner wall of the first shell 1 and the inner part of the second shell 8 are fixedly connected with the bamboo charcoal layer 20 respectively, and the outer wall surface of the bamboo charcoal layer 20 is fixedly connected with the sponge block 2;
a first sleeve 3 and a second sleeve 14 are fixedly connected between the first shell 1 and the second shell 8, the middle part of the first sleeve 3 is rotatably connected with a first threaded rod 4, one end of the first threaded rod 4 is fixedly connected with a first bearing 17, the surface of the outer wall of the first bearing 17 is fixedly connected with a first push plate 5, the rubber pad 6 is pushed to contact with the neck of a patient by rotating the first threaded rod 4 along the first sleeve 3, the second threaded rod 15 is rotated along the second sleeve 14, the rubber pad 6 is pushed by the second threaded rod 15 to fix the waist of the patient, the protection device is conveniently fixed on the body of the patient, and the upper body of the patient can be fixed;
one end of the second threaded rod 15 is fixedly connected with a second bearing 21, the outer wall surface of the second bearing 21 is fixedly connected with a second push plate 16, the first push plate 5 and the second push plate 16 are respectively fixedly connected with a rubber pad 6, so that the device can be fixed at the waist, the outer wall surface of the first shell 1 and the outer wall surface of the second shell 8 are respectively fixedly connected with a connecting block 7, the connecting blocks 7 are fixed by bolts, the outer wall surface of the first shell 1 and the outer wall surface of the second shell 8 are respectively fixedly connected with a rotating shaft 12, the outer wall surface of the rotating shaft 12 is rotatably connected with a shell cover 13, one end of the shell cover 13 is fixedly connected with a buckle 19, the outer wall surface of the first shell 1 and the outer wall surface of the second shell 8 are respectively provided with a clamping groove 18, the inner wall surface of the clamping groove 18 is slidably connected with the buckle 19, and the outer wall surfaces of the first shell 1 and the second shell 8 are respectively provided with a notch 9, the shell cover is convenient to be fixed with the first shell and the second shell.
When the device is used, a human body is placed between the first shell 1 and the second shell 8, the first shell 1 and the second shell 8 are fixedly connected through bolts, the first threaded rod 4 is rotated to be along the first sleeve 3, the first threaded rod 4 pushes the rubber pad 6 to contact the neck of a patient, the second threaded rod 15 is rotated to be along the second sleeve 14, the second threaded rod 15 pushes the rubber pad 6 to fix the waist of the patient, the protection device is conveniently fixed on the body of the patient, the upper body of the patient can be fixed, the sponge block 2 is arranged inside the first shell 1 and the second shell 8, the whole comfort degree of the device is conveniently improved, the bamboo charcoal layer 20 is arranged inside the first shell 1 and the second shell 8, and the bamboo charcoal has a loose and porous structure, is fine and porous in molecules, has strong adsorption capacity, peculiar smell elimination, moisture absorption and mildew prevention are achieved, Bacteriostatic expelling parasite, the moisture absorption sweat-absorbing of being convenient for, promote human blood circulation and metabolism, alleviate fatigue, and through set up ventilative gauze 11 in first casing 1 outside and second casing 8 outside, be convenient for make the human unblocked that keeps the outside air in first casing 1 and second casing 8 are inside, through pressing buckle 19 from the inside roll-off of draw-in groove 18, be convenient for open cap 13, be convenient for change the medicine to the patient.
The application has the advantages that:
1. the first threaded rod is rotated along the first sleeve, the rubber pad is pushed by the first threaded rod to contact the neck of the patient, the second threaded rod is rotated along the second sleeve, the rubber pad is pushed by the second threaded rod to fix the waist of the patient, the protection device is convenient to fix on the body of the patient, and the upper body of the patient can be fixed;
2. through at first casing and the inside bamboo charcoal layer that sets up of second casing, have loose porous structure through the bamboo charcoal, its molecule is fine and close porous, has very strong adsorption efficiency, eliminate the peculiar smell, the moisture absorption is mould proof, antibacterial expelling parasite, the moisture absorption sweat-absorbing of being convenient for promotes human blood circulation and metabolism, alleviates fatigue, and through setting up ventilative gauze in first casing outside and second casing outside, be convenient for make the human unblocked that keeps the outside air in first casing and second casing inside.
